Form 4: Jamf Holding Corp. CIO Linh Lam Reports Sale of Common Stock
SEC Form 4 Filing
Linh Lam, CIO of Jamf Holding Corp., reported the sale of 47,815 shares of common stock at a price of $13.5996 per share on March 19, 2025, according to a Form 4 filing.
Summary
- On March 19, 2025, Linh Lam, the CIO of Jamf Holding Corp., sold 47,815 shares of common stock.
- The sale was executed at a price of $13.5996 per share.
- Following the transaction, Lam directly owns 253,518 shares of Jamf Holding Corp.
- The sale was conducted under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an adopted on May 21, 2024.
- The shares were sold in multiple transactions with prices ranging from $13.46 to $13.70.

Industry Context
This filing is a routine disclosure of insider trading activity. It's common for executives to sell shares under pre-arranged trading plans to avoid accusations of trading on inside information.
